Close to where the blue digger is on the photo was a massive flowering currant an ornamental shrub that flowers in spring, it was about twelve foot in height and every spring was alive with bees, both bumbles and honey, buzzing around the flowers obviously rich in nectar.
It most probably was left over from a garden of one of the cottages that was there at one time, however that and other trees and shrubs were cleared in the early 1980s when the council had the whole area levelled with those massive landscaping machines.
